1.引入依赖,配置数据源
<dependency>
<groupId>com.baomidou</groupId>
<artifactId>mybatis-plus-boot-starter</artifactId>
<version>3.4.1</version>
</dependency>
2.根据数据库表创建一个实体类,一个mapper接口(继承BaseMapper接口)并在主启动类上添加mapper的包扫描
@Data//使用lombok
@AllArgsConstructor//有参并且是全参构造
@NoArgsConstructor//无参构造
public class User {
@TableId(type = IdType.AUTO)//主键使用雪花算法,数据库中也必须是递增的
private Integer id;
private String name;
private Integer age;
private String sex;
@TableLogic//当删除时只更改数据状态不删除数据
private int deleted;
@TableField(fill = FieldFill.INSERT)//自动填充
private Date createtime;
@TableField(fill = FieldFill.INSERT_UPDATE)
private Date updatetime;
public User(Integer id, String name, Integer age, String sex, int deleted) {
this.id = id;